itsmattkc 323718bc11 moved timeline undoable commands to using the new NodeAddCommand
Previous iteration used some "magic code" that added clips automatically to the
timeline. This was functional but ultimately outside of the undo commands'
control meaning nodes could be infinitely added and abandoned. This makes the
add process part of the undo command which means it's all undoable as the user
would expect.

#include "graph.h"
NodeGraph::NodeGraph()
{
}
void NodeGraph::Clear()
{
foreach (Node* node, node_children_) {
delete node;
}
node_children_.clear();
}
void NodeGraph::AddNode(Node *node)
{
if (ContainsNode(node)) {
return;
}
node->setParent(this);
connect(node, SIGNAL(EdgeAdded(NodeEdgePtr)), this, SIGNAL(EdgeAdded(NodeEdgePtr)));
connect(node, SIGNAL(EdgeRemoved(NodeEdgePtr)), this, SIGNAL(EdgeRemoved(NodeEdgePtr)));
node_children_.append(node);
emit NodeAdded(node);
}
void NodeGraph::TakeNode(Node *node, QObject* new_parent)
{
if (!ContainsNode(node)) {
return;
}
if (!node->CanBeDeleted()) {
qWarning() << "Tried to delete a Node that's been flagged as not deletable";
return;
}
node->DisconnectAll();
disconnect(node, SIGNAL(EdgeAdded(NodeEdgePtr)), this, SIGNAL(EdgeAdded(NodeEdgePtr)));
disconnect(node, SIGNAL(EdgeRemoved(NodeEdgePtr)), this, SIGNAL(EdgeRemoved(NodeEdgePtr)));
node->setParent(new_parent);
node_children_.removeAll(node);
emit NodeRemoved(node);
}
const QList<Node *> &NodeGraph::nodes()
{
return node_children_;
}
bool NodeGraph::ContainsNode(Node *n)
{
return (n->parent() == this);
}
